Seems like there's a lot of parallelism you could exploit here and make the pipeline much, much faster.
I suggest you: 1) in the main program, even before starting the pipeline, read the tar.gz file and extract the 4 filenames. 2) create the pipeline containing 1 TextIO.Read transform per filename you extracted, and Flatten the resulting PCollections 3) apply the rest of the pipeline This way not only you'll be reading 4 files in parallel, but each file itself will be read in parallel within the file.
